Subject: DR drill — catalogue import, Thursday

Hi all,

Thursday we rehearse restoring the Brindlemoor Library catalogue import pipeline from cold backups. New team members should shadow the restore of the MARC staging tables and note timings. The drill ends when search indexing resumes on the standby cluster. To unlock the offline backup set during the exercise, use the passphrase written directly below this message.

recovery phrase for fahif-yawig: fenvan-praox-wenax-pramir-prair-tamix-rusiel-casdor-julir-novys-fenmir-sorius-kelix

## Step 4: Enable payload compression

Before promoting build 7.2 of Lanternfall to staging, switch the telemetry agent to compressed payloads. The collector on Veylight Hub accepts zstd as of this release, and uncompressed traffic will be rejected after the cutover window. Update each edge node's agent config, restart the telemetry daemon, and verify ingest counters stay flat for ten minutes. Apply the following settings to every node in the fleet:

settings of bafog-bagug:
druwyn:
  pin: 2480
  metrics_host: metrics.druwyn.tolvaqlabs.internal
  tenant: ulaath
  seal: seal_26cd47c5

## Temporary Site Access — Harwick Annex

During the Mellor House renovation, reception operates from the Harwick Annex, ground floor. Main entrance is sealed; direct all visitors to the Annex side door on Cobble Lane. Deliveries go to the rear yard only. Annex door locks automatically after 18:00. To open it out of hours, use the code below.

door code, yagap-bahof: bdg-O-05